Mexico Consumer Packaged Goods Market Overview

Market Valuation :

Mexico's CPG market is valued at USD 87,180 million in 2025, with strong growth momentum driven by domestic consumption and retail expansion across urban and emerging markets.

Robust Growth Trajectory :

The market is projected to reach USD 111,480 million by 2030, representing a 5.0% CAGR, outpacing the global average of 4.2% and reflecting Mexico's economic resilience.

Middle Class Expansion :

Rising disposable incomes and an expanding middle class in Mexico are driving increased spending on packaged food and beverage products, particularly in premium and convenience categories.

Urbanization & Retail Growth :

Rapid urbanization and the proliferation of modern retail channels, including e-commerce and quick-commerce platforms, are reshaping consumer purchasing behaviors across Mexico's major metropolitan areas.

    Market Definition

    Consumer Packaged Goods (CPG) are products that consumers use on a daily or frequent basis and that are consumed quickly, requiring regular repurchase. These goods are typically low-cost, non-durable items packaged for retail sale, including categories such as food and beverages, personal care products, cosmetics, cleaning supplies, and household items.
